For years now, the rival Roman generals Caesar and Pompey have engaged in a contest for world domination. Gordianus the Finder and his ailing wife Bethesda travel to Egypt - Bethesda's homeland - seeking a cure for her enduring, mysterious illness. At the same time Gordianus the Finder is traveling to Egypt with his ailing Egyptian wife, Bethesda. They arrive as the Civil War between Caesar and Pompey is reaching its conclusion on its shores.
